Dutch vs Immigrants from England Receiving Food Stamps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 551,299,483 people shows a poor positive correlation between the proportion of Dutch and percentage of population receiving government assistance and/or food stamps in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.170 and weighted average of 10.0%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 390,689,765 people shows a very strong posit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from England and percentage of population receiving government assistance and/or food stamps in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.848 and weighted average of 10.0%, a difference of 0.13%.
